My mom used to take her cat out for short Sunday drives around the neighborhood at slow speeds (25 MPH). It seemed like her cat enjoyed the fresh air and sunshine and never attempted to jump out of the car. She was an indoor cat at the time because of her extreme age (20+ years). This was what I was referring to. I wasn't talking about taking a feline friend on a long drive at high speed. Cats can be pretty versatile. I have a friend who keeps on in his RV and they travel around the country. (Thet are in Arizona right now.) I used to know a guy who lived on a 33 foot sailboat and he had a cat who sailed with him all over the world. It knew better than to jump overboard.... It had friends in most every port he visited. Funny that had he had a dog, they would have made him quarantine him, but they apparently didn't care about cats...... |
